Scissors Congruence with Mixed Dimensions

Abstract

We introduce a Grothendieck group En for bounded polytopes in \mathbb Rn. It differs from the usual Euclidean scissors congruence group in that lower-dimensional polytopes are not ignored. We also define an analogous group Ln using germs of polytopes at a point, which is related to spherical scissors congruence. This provides a setting for a generalization of the Dehn invariant.
